20 items including hundreds of pages of letters and transcripts, have been submitted to the courts as the case of Dorothy Day versus the Danbury Zoning Board of Appeals moves forward. The Roy estate sued over a cease and desist order issued by the City's Zoning Enforcement Officer in 2016. The City maintains that Dorothy Day renewed their one-year special permit for the Spring Street facility once in the mid-80s, and then has been operating without a permit ever since. The trial is slated to be held in June, in the Hartford Judicial District.
